logo

Output 31760ae7bd57fa8169332a7fd8868111a735699a7d3f6b1dccdfd1878afb9569:1

value
45378146
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fbaa417741cd65cb35061e78d2409b9c6c905f3 OP_EQUALVERIFY OP_CHECKSIG
address
18GZyCTBZwTdykjbzyjzmgYEeimAvcz9B2
transaction
31760ae7bd57fa8169332a7fd8868111a735699a7d3f6b1dccdfd1878afb9569